Synopsis

Neither the date nor the authorship of the Dhammapada is known, but there is conclusive evidence that this monument of the Buddhist canon existed well before the Christian era. Many scholars agree in ascribing its utterances to Buddha himself, while others are of the opinion that it is a compilation made by Buddhist monks from various sources.This classic religious text focuses on practical morality, which, if practiced earnestly and diligently, will lead the practitioner to Nirvana, the state of unconditioned eternal bliss. By following these injunctions, says the Buddha, “the wise man may make for himself an island which no flood can overwhelm.”

Author Bio

Friedrich Max Müller (1823–1900) was a scholar and Orientalist. He is best known as the editor of The Sacred Books of the East, a fifty-volume set of English translations of canonical texts of the major eastern religions.
